| This is a class for the true beginner! With a lot of hands-on practice, students will learn computer basics the fun way! Instruction includes computer terminology, as well as how to use the mouse and keyboard, create letters, and store information for later use. Price includes textbook. Instructor: Tom Bennett. | A class for those wanting to know more! This class is the continuation to Introduction to Computers for Seniors. Participants will gain a deeper understanding of how easy it is to use a personal computer. Students will revisit and delve deeper into some familiar topics as well as exploring new components. This class will emphasize hands on exercises designed to make participants more comfortable with using the computer. Prerequisite: Introduction to Computers for Seniors. Price includes textbook.
